Mesothelioma lawyers can assist victims and their loved ones comprehend the options for compensation. They will determine if they are eligible by looking at the evidence, the statute of limitations in each state and the type of claim.

If a mesothelioma case is successful, victims will be compensated for medical bills and other expenses. It also sends a message that asbestos companies that are negligent will be held accountable for their negligence.

Compensation for expenses

Compensation is available to a variety of victims and their families to help pay for treatment expenses. These expenses may include funeral costs, and living costs. A mesothelioma lawyer can help determine the best method to pursue compensation for these losses.

Many patients have been forced to put their lives in a bind as they undergo mesothelioma therapies. These interruptions can cause anxiety and disrupt family lives. In the end, many families have faced financial difficulties. Settlements for mesothelioma can help to address these challenges. The money can also be used to assist with other financial obligations, such as car or mortgage payments.

A mesothelioma lawyer can bring a lawsuit or asbestos trust fund claim on behalf of a patient and their family members. This is a quicker and more effective method to get compensation than trying to do it yourself. However every case is unique, and some jurisdictions have statutes of limitations that limit the time you can make a claim.

Lawsuits may also require a series of court proceedings, referred to as discovery, in which both sides can seek documents and information from the other. This could include depositions in person or written. A mesothelioma legal group will collect and analyze the evidence to create a strong argument for compensation.

Mesothelioma settlements can be life-changing sums, and they can cover a broad range of costs. Settlements can also offer the security needed when a patient or family members move forward with their mesothelioma care.

In the 1990s class-action lawsuits were commonplace, but they are not as common in the present. Instead, it is more common to pursue the personal injury or wrongful death lawsuit, or to file for mesothelioma damages from an asbestos trust fund for bankruptcy.

Asbestos patients who served in the military could be eligible for additional compensation. These benefits include veterans’ pensions and disability benefits that can help cover a range of medical and financial expenses. Asbestos trust funds are created by companies who once produced, used or sold asbestos-containing products. These companies are now bankrupt but trusts have money to give to victims.

Medical Bills

A diagnosis of mesothelioma can be an event that changes the lives of patients and their families. While a patient’s primary focus should be on receiving treatments that can prolong their life expectancy but they also have to deal with other financial burdens, like insurance co-pays, travel costs for treatment, and loss of income.

Fortunately, compensation awarded through mesothelioma lawsuits can assist those who have been exposed to asbestos pay for these expenses. Settlements from lawsuits will help families maintain financial stability following the death of a loved one.

A mesothelioma lawyer who is experienced can help patients find sources to cover the expenses of treatment. Lawyers can also help with the process of filing a mesothelioma case to help ensure that victims receive the maximum compensation possible.

Numerous sources of compensation may be available to patients suffering from mesothelioma, including benefits for veterans and asbestos trust funds. These funds are accessible to those who have been diagnosed with asbestos-related ailments such as mesothelioma law firms, and who were exposed to asbestos during work.

The first step to accessing these resources involves determining the mesothelioma treatments that are covered under a patient’s medical coverage. Each health plan has its own specific rules regarding deductibles, out-of pocket limits and in-network providers, among other. A mesothelioma attorney can assist clients to understand their coverage and keep track of costs. They can also assist with any billing mistakes that may occur.

People who are not insured or underinsured might be eligible for financial aid through mesothelioma lawsuits or state-sponsored programs. Some states offer grant programs to cancer patients who are unable to afford health insurance.

Lost Income

In certain situations the patient could be given compensation to pay for expenses such as lost wages. This compensation could help pay for the loss of income due to mesothelioma treatments, travel costs, and other costs. Compensation from trust funds and lawsuits is usually tax-free, however any interest earned from the settlements or verdicts may be taxable.

Mesothelioma lawyers can help clients be aware of the impact mesothelioma plays on their financial health, as well as how compensation can help address it. Attorneys can explain how compensation amounts are affected by personal goals and the nature of the case.

A mesothelioma law firms lawyer can determine a client’s eligibility upon their medical history and exposure to asbestos. They can help their clients file a suit against asbestos companies that are responsible, which could lead to financial compensation. A lawyer can handle every legal detail so a victim and their family members can focus on their recovery.

The most common types of mesothelioma lawsuits are personal injury claims and wrongful death claims. A mesothelioma claim may be filed by survivors of a deceased loved one, as long as the estate hasn’t received compensation from another source.

The lawsuits for wrongful death are filed by the heirs of an asbestos-exposured person who passed away from mesothelioma. These lawsuits are intended to hold asbestos companies accountable for their negligent actions that caused a victim’s illness.

Asbestos-related victims can also be compensated through private insurance and government programs. policies. This includes veterans and disability benefits. These benefits can be used to pay for mesothelioma treatment, home health care and much more.

Suffering and Pain

Mesothelioma lawyers can aid you receive compensation for your physical and emotional suffering. Pain and suffering is the term for the discomfort, discomfort, anxiety, and emotional stress a victim experiences due to their injury. Physical pain and suffering is related to the impact of the injury on the life of a victim. For instance when mesothelioma symptoms result in them having difficulty walking or driving for a longer period of time. Mental discomfort and suffering could include depression, anger and loss of appetite and insomnia.

Mesothelioma is a rare, but deadly form of cancer that affects the tissues that line the organs and structures in the body. It is most often found in the tissue that surrounds the lungs (pleura) however, it can also occur in the tissues around the stomach and the heart, as well as in the testicles.
